CINDY SAYS: As was the case last weekend, the weather will be split down the middle with rain Saturday followed by improving conditions on Sunday. The one constant will be the wind. It will blow from the SE with gusts to 60 km/h as the rain rolls through then shift to the W overnight into Sunday morning as the clearing pushes in. Sunday’s wind will also gust between 50 and 70 km/h. High temperatures will be in the low single digits on Remembrance Day. I don’t see much of a break between fall storms – I’m watching a developing system over the American Midwest that is showing signs of intense cyclogenesis – aka Weather Bomb intensification. The leading edge of that powerful storm would reach our region by Wednesday with more rain and possible damaging wind!
